Idaho Fire Emergency Preparedness Checklist: This checklist is a comprehensive resource that outlines the crucial steps to follow in case of a fire emergency in Idaho. It encompasses the following key elements: a. Fire Safety Measures: — Smoke alarms installation and maintenance — Establishing designated meeting points — Clearing escape routes and ensuring easy access to exits — Regular fire drills and practicing fire escape plans — Educating residents about fire hazards and prevention b. Communication and Alert Systems: — Ensuring functional fire alarm systems — Knowledge of emergency phone numbers (911) — Informing local fire departments about potential hazards or special circumstances — Installing fire sprinkler systems, fire extinguishers, and fire blankets — Placing emergency signage and evacuation maps in easily visible locations c. Building Safety: — Regular maintenance of heating systems, chimneys, electrical wiring, and appliances — Adequate fire-rated doors, walls, and windows — Fire-resistant materials and furnishings — Clearing flammable materials from near the building — Checking fire extinguishers' condition and accessibility d. Emergency Evacuation Plan: — Designating different exit points for various areas and floors — Ensuring clear pathways, avoiding obstacles — Assigning roles and responsibilities to designated individuals — Assessing the need for assistance and accommodating special needs individuals — Identifying secondary meeting points in case the primary one is compromised e. Fire Prevention Education: — Conducting fire prevention training programs — Educating residents on fire prevention measures — Monitoring and enforcing fire safety regulations and procedures — Promoting awareness campaigns and distributing informational brochures 2. In response to a fire, you should first sound the alarm and alert others in the vicinity. Next, follow your established escape routes as outlined in the Idaho Checklist - Emergency Procedures in Case of Fire. If safe to do so, use a fire extinguisher for small fires, but ensure your safety is your priority. Once you have evacuated, call the fire department and do not re-enter the building until it is declared safe.
